The Earth’s climate has changed throughout history.During the ice age and thawin point it changed. Today’s warming is of importance and concern because it is highly likely to be the result of human activity.

The planet’s average surface temperature has risen about 2.0 degrees Fahrenheit since the late 19th century, a change driven largely by increased carbon dioxide and other human-made emissions into the atmosphere. The causes of global warming can be directly linked to CO2 levels varied in tandem with the glacial cycles.

During warm periods, CO2 levels were higher. During cool “glacial” periods, CO2 levels were lower. When incoming energy from the Sun is absorbed by the Earth system, Earth warms. When the Sun’s energy is reflected back into space, Earth avoids warming. When absorbed energy is released back into space, Earth cools. Most of these climate changes are attributed to very small changes in Earth’s orbit that influence the amount of solar energy earth receives.
